    Absolutely. If you’re not a prostitute for miles, run 1150 miles and get paid a salary which equates to a dollar a mile, in this case it’s a mute point. Pay me a dollar a mile for 1150 miles, and I won’t worry one bit about a bonus. Again, like what has been said over and over again in this thread, a salary every week far outweighs chasing miles.

    At this point in my life, I care very much about my house, my pool, my retirement account, my vacations and my lifestyle, all brought to me by miles run from my job, real estate from my wife’s job, and a hefty milestone that we passed on Friday, my house and pool that I care about now has I Year left on it’s mortgage. You see, it all derived from money, which comes from miles. I, like most other OTR drivers get paid for miles run. My point was, it’s much better getting paid by salary then miles, for most people. I’m in a very unique situation, I don’t need a bonus to make my bills, so if I was in his position, I’d take that salary over any form of mileage pay, with those miles he ran, and the salary he gets, who cares about a monthly mileage bonus? I mean we’re probably talking about $300? Maybe I didn’t clarify myself, but if I’m away from everything I’ve worked for the last 40 years, I’d want to work, not sit. The salary is good for the miles run, but the down time would have me on a plane to the house, which I have done about 4 times the last 20 years.
